premium manufacturing environment. Summary The Engineering Process
& Testing Intern supports the Engineering team by assisting with
testing, initial setup, and validation of new and existing
manufacturing processes. This role focuses on hands-on support for
the introduction of a new reaction injection molding (RIM) process,
as well as validation and process control of the in-house 3D recoil
pad manufacturing process. The intern will assist with testing
procedures, data collection, documentation, and continuous
improvement efforts while working closely alongside an Engineering

process control, and documentation. What You'll Do Assist with the
initial setup and testing of a new reaction injection molding (RIM)
process and for the in-house 3D recoil pad manufacturing process.
Support other testing activities under the guidance of the
Engineering team. Help collect, record, and organize test data
related to process performance and consistency. Support process
control activities, including documentation of procedures,
settings, and results. Prepare parts, materials, and test setups
required for testing and validation activities. Observe and follow
established testing procedures, safety standards, and documentation
practices. Assist with documenting test results, observations, and
improvement opportunities. Collaborate with engineering,
manufacturing, and quality partners as needed to support project
goals and overall company objectives. Qualifications Current
